7 min read

Cyclotron Unleashed: ICP's Quantum Leap in On-Chain AI

Cyclotron Unleashed: ICP's Quantum Leap in On-Chain AI

Get ready to have your minds blown because the Internet Computer Protocol (ICP) just hit a major milestone with their Cyclotron upgrade! 🎉 We're talking a quantum leap for AI on the blockchain, guys. It's like ICP strapped on a rocket pack and zoomed past the competition.🚀

So, what's all the fuss about? Well, Cyclotron has supercharged ICP's ability to run AI models directly on the blockchain. Yeah, you heard that right – no more clunky workarounds or third-party servers. This is pure, unadulterated, on-chain AI magic!

The Cyclotron Milestone: A New Era for AI on Blockchain

Alright brainiacs, let's get down to brass tacks! Think of it as a turbocharged engine for running complex AI models right on the ICP network. 🏎️

Cyclotron wasn't just some random idea cooked up in a lab. It was a community-approved proposal (Proposal 13094, for all you protocol nerds out there) that aimed to give ICP the muscle to handle AI inference – that's the fancy way of saying "using AI models to make predictions or decisions."

Cyclotron isn't just about using AI models; it's about training them on-chain too. That's right, the ICP crew is swinging for the fences here, aiming to make the Internet Computer the go-to platform for developing and deploying AI applications. It's a bold vision, but hey, who doesn't love a good moonshot? 🚀🌕

ICP Roadmap: Trustworthy AI on the Blockchain
The ICP roadmap makes the way for decentralized AI with Cyclotron and Gyrotron, making AI on the blockchain trustworthy, powerful, and transparent.

Why On-Chain AI is a Big Deal

So, you might be wondering, why all the hype about running AI on the blockchain? Isn't that just for crypto bros and tech wizards? Well, my friends, let me tell you, on-chain AI is a game-changer, and here's why.

First off, AI is a hungry beast. It gobbles up computing power like it's an all-you-can-eat buffet. Running complex AI models requires a ton of processing power, which is usually handled by massive data centers. But what if we could cut out the middleman and run those models directly on the blockchain? That's where ICP's Cyclotron comes in, flexing its muscles and showing the world that blockchain isn't just for Bitcoin anymore. 💪

But it's not just about showing off. On-chain AI opens up a whole new world of possibilities. Think decentralized AI applications that are more transparent, secure, and resistant to censorship. Imagine AI models that can learn and evolve on the blockchain, without the need for centralized control. It's like giving AI the freedom to roam the digital wild west! 🤠

And let's not forget the real-world impact. ICP's on-chain AI is already powering applications like facial recognition and image classification. This technology could revolutionize industries like healthcare, finance, and even social media. The possibilities are endless! 🤩

Under the Hood: Optimizations That Power Cyclotron's Magic

Now tech enthusiasts, we're about to get a little geeky! 🤓 Cyclotron isn't just about big ideas; it's about clever engineering and serious optimizations that make on-chain AI a reality.

Deterministic Floating-Point Operations: The Foundation of Blockchain AI

First up, we have "deterministic floating-point operations." Sounds like a mouthful, right? But it's actually pretty simple. In the blockchain world, everything needs to be predictable and consistent across all the computers in the network. That means even the tiniest calculations have to be done in a way that always gives the same answer, no matter who's doing the math. ICP's brilliant engineers found a way to make these deterministic floating-point operations lightning fast, which is like giving the blockchain a caffeine boost. ☕⚡

SIMD: The Power of Parallel Processing

Next, we have SIMD, which stands for "Single Instruction, Multiple Data." This is where things get really exciting. Imagine you have a bunch of tasks to do, and instead of doing them one by one, you could magically clone yourself and do them all at the same time. That's kind of what SIMD does, but with computer instructions instead of human clones. By executing multiple calculations simultaneously, SIMD can give AI applications a major speed boost, making them run like a cheetah on roller skates. 🐆🛼

Sonos Tract: An AI Engine Supercharged for ICP

Finally, we have Sonos Tract, an open-source AI inference engine that ICP's engineers helped supercharge. Not only did they make it faster, but they also added support for those fancy SIMD instructions we just talked about. It's like giving Sonos Tract a new pair of running shoes and a personal trainer all in one! 👟🏋️‍♀️

These optimizations are like the secret sauce that makes Cyclotron so powerful.

Real-World Results: Cyclotron in Action

Alright folks, enough with the theory, let's see Cyclotron in action! 🚀 After all, the proof is in the pudding, or in this case, the benchmark results. 📊

Get this: Cyclotron cranked up the speed of AI tasks on ICP by a whopping 5 to 19 times! That's like going from a leisurely stroll to a full-on sprint.🏃‍♂️💨

But don't just take my word for it. The ICP team put Cyclotron through its paces with a variety of AI models, including:

  • Image Classification: This model can tell you what's in a picture faster than you can say "cheese!" 📸
  • Face Detection: It spots faces in images with the accuracy of a hawk. 🦅
  • Face Recognition: This one can identify your friends better than your mom can. 👩‍👦
  • GPT2: A language model that can write poetry, code, and even generate wacky pickup lines (not that I recommend using those). 🤖💬
Source: DFINITY Medium Post

The best part? You can check out all the juicy details and source code on GitHub. Transparency is the name of the game in the blockchain world, and the ICP team is all about it.

So, there you have it! Cyclotron isn't just a fancy name; it's a real game-changer that's already delivering impressive results. And this is just the beginning. The future of AI on the blockchain is bright, my friends, and ICP is leading the charge.

The Future: Gyrotron and Beyond

ICP isn't stopping at Cyclotron. They've got their sights set on an even bigger, bolder milestone called Gyrotron. 🚀

What's Gyrotron all about, you ask? Well, my friends, get ready for the GPU revolution! 🎮 Cyclotron was all about squeezing every ounce of performance out of the CPU, but Gyrotron is taking things to the next level by harnessing the power of specialized graphics processors. These GPUs are like rocket fuel for AI, capable of handling even the most complex and computationally intensive tasks.

With Gyrotron, ICP is aiming to run massive AI models on-chain that were previously unimaginable. Think self-driving cars, medical diagnosis systems, and even AI-powered virtual worlds. It's like opening a portal to a whole new dimension of possibilities. 🌌

But Gyrotron isn't just about raw power. It's about building a decentralized AI ecosystem that benefits everyone. By providing the infrastructure for on-chain AI, ICP is empowering developers, researchers, and entrepreneurs to create the next generation of AI applications. It's a future where AI isn't controlled by a handful of tech giants, but by a global community of innovators.

Conclusion: The Dawn of a New AI Era on ICP

Alright, ICP people, let's wrap this up! 🚀 We've covered a lot of ground today, from the ins and outs of Cyclotron to the mind-blowing potential of on-chain AI. But here's the TL;DR (too long; didn't read) for all you busy bees:

  • Cyclotron is a game-changer: It's unleashed the power of AI on the ICP blockchain, pushing the boundaries of what's possible.
  • On-chain AI is the future: It's more secure, transparent, and decentralized than traditional AI, and it's poised to revolutionize everything from healthcare to finance.
  • ICP is leading the charge: With Cyclotron under its belt and Gyrotron on the horizon, ICP is the undisputed king of the on-chain AI jungle.

Now Dive into the GitHub code, join the ICP community, and get ready for the wild ride that is the future of AI on the blockchain. Trust me, you won't want to miss it! 😎


Disclaimer

*The information and analysis provided in this article are intended for educational and informational purposes only and should not be considered as financial, investment, or professional advice. While our team strives to ensure the accuracy and reliability of the content, we make no representations or warranties of any kind, express or implied, about the completeness, accuracy, reliability, suitability, or availability of the information presented.

The content within this article may include opinions and forward-looking statements that involve risks and uncertainties. The blockchain and cryptocurrency markets are highly volatile, and past performance is not indicative of future results. Any reliance you place on the information presented is strictly at your own risk. Before making any investment decisions, we highly recommend consulting with a qualified financial advisor or conducting your own thorough research.

By accessing and using the information provided in this article, you acknowledge and agree that neither the authors, publishers, nor any other party involved in the creation or delivery of the content shall be held liable for any direct, indirect, incidental, consequential, or punitive damages, including but not limited to loss of profits, goodwill, or data, arising out of your use or inability to use the information provided or any actions you take based on the information contained within this section.*